Finding the Right T-Shirt Manufacturer: A Comprehensive Guide

Wiki Article

Securing a dependable t-shirt manufacturer is vitally important for any apparel brand . The journey can feel overwhelming , but this overview offers practical advice to help you find the perfect partner . First, clarify your needs: consider factors like order volume, desired fabric types , printing techniques , and budget. Then, investigate potential manufacturers – look for those with positive reviews , experience in your niche, and a commitment to ethical standards . Don't forget to request samples and check their quality inspection procedures before making a final selection. Finally, build a strong, open connection with your chosen manufacturer for long-term success.

Selecting a Dependable T-Shirt Supplier

When it comes to sourcing clothing, the balance between quality and price is crucial. Finding a suitable t-shirt manufacturer can be a difficulty, especially if you’re aiming for both superior products and competitive pricing. Don't simply choose the cheapest option; assess factors like their production methods, material suppliers, minimum order amounts, and overall reputation. A reputable manufacturer will offer a combination of high-grade fabrics, consistent construction, and responsive customer service, even if it means a slightly higher initial expense. Remember to request samples and thoroughly inspect them before committing to a larger order to ensure they meet your brand’s standards.

T-Shirt Manufacturing Trends Shaping the Industry

The clothing industry is experiencing major shifts, and t-shirt manufacturing is no exception. We're seeing a rise in demand for green materials like organic cotton and bamboo. Robotics plays an increasingly role, with printers embracing direct-to-garment (DTG) and digital printing technologies to offer customized designs and reduce order requirements. Furthermore, nearshoring and reshoring – bringing manufacturing closer to consumer markets – are gaining momentum due to distribution concerns and a desire for faster shipping times. The focus is now on responsiveness and creating limited batches of t-shirts to meet evolving consumer demands.
